As the final battles of the Elbaph arc unfold in the One Piece manga, Eiichiro Oda has set the stage for the Straw Hat Pirates to gain some serious Haki power-ups. This development gives us insight into the crew’s positioning as we approach the series’ endgame.
According to Game Rant’s analysis of the arc’s direction, several Straw Hats are gearing up for Haki enhancements as the confrontations in Elbaph heat up. This fits into a larger trend Oda has been developing in the Final Saga: mastery of Haki is increasingly becoming the standard that differentiates top-tier fighters from the rest.
Zoro looks like the first to benefit from this change. Screen Rant pointed out that Zoro’s next major power-up has been hinted at, and it seems to revolve around a Haki breakthrough, rather than a new sword or technique. Since Zoro’s Conqueror’s Haki was confirmed during Wano, fans expect that Elbaph will fine-tune his ability to use it, bringing him closer to Mihawk’s level.
This development aligns with a broader shift in One Piece’s power dynamics. Comic Book Resources recently highlighted five ways Haki is reducing the importance of Devil Fruits in the Final Saga. This change makes these upgrades more impactful than your average mid-arc power boost. If Haki is becoming the main measure of strength, the Straw Hats need to seize these opportunities before the series heads into its final conflicts.
This comes on the heels of a two-week period filled with significant manga developments. On July 10, fans saw two Straw Hats reach what many are calling “god-tier” status. Additionally, a chapter from July 8 addressed Gear 5’s crucial weakness after four years of fan speculation. Oda is clearly ramping up the crew’s growth in a short timeframe, suggesting that Elbaph serves as the last major power-scaling arc before we dive into the endgame.
For fans who enjoy the story through gaming, One Piece Odyssey — developed by ILCA and published by Bandai Namco — is the latest major video game in the franchise, launched in January 2023. The game boasts 80% positive reviews based on 1,832 Steam ratings. However, its current player count of 40 indicates that it has mostly run its course with players. The mixed reception shows that the manga’s momentum hasn’t sparked a renewed interest in gaming.
| One Piece Odyssey Release Date | January 13, 2023 |
| Steam Review Score | 80% positive |
| Total Steam Reviews | 1,832 |
| Current Steam Players | 40 |
| Current Steam Price | $39.99 |
Community feedback around One Piece Odyssey has turned sour since its launch. One reviewer on Steam stated: “this game made me want to pull my hair out, EVERYTHING is padded for time, it even stalls you from picking up collectible items. I paid 3 cents for this and I still wouldn’t recommend it at that price.” Complaints about pacing recur in negative reviews, highlighting a design flaw that discounts haven’t resolved.
